Environmentally conscious disposal of brush heads and accessories

For optimal oral hygiene, we recommend replacing your toothbrush attachment after two months. The brush heads for the KOA V2 sonic toothbrush are made from renewable raw materials and are biodegradable. To make it compostable, simply remove the organic plastic interior and castor oil bristles. Find out from your local authorities which bin you can dispose of the attachment in. This varies from place to place.

Notes on battery disposal

In connection with the distribution of batteries or the delivery of devices containing batteries, we are obliged to inform you of the following:

As an end user, you are legally obliged to return used batteries. The symbols shown on the batteries have the following meaning:

The symbol of the crossed out garbage can means that the battery must not be disposed of with household waste.

Pb = Battery contains more than 0.004 percent lead by mass
Cd = battery contains more than 0.002 percent cadmium by mass
Hg = Battery contains more than 0.0005 percent mercury by mass.

In accordance with European guidelines and the German Electrical and Electronic Equipment Act (ElektroG), old devices and all electronic parts included in the scope of delivery may not be disposed of with household waste. The symbol opposite means that the old device and the electronic parts included in the scope of delivery must be disposed of separately from household waste for the purpose of reuse.
